篇名 鼓勵外資政策與國家間衝突之分析(1970-2001)

中文摘要

鼓勵外來直接投資政策是否隱含國家不願意運用武力來解決國家 間衝突的意涵?本文之目的在檢驗國家的提倡外資政策與其主動開啓 軍事衝突間的關聯。透過檢視國家的意向,本文認爲鼓勵外資政策隱 含國家傾向和平的意涵,這是由於下列兩點因素:首先、ー國的鼓勵 外資政策與其主動開啓軍事衝突無法相容,因爲後者將對國家吸引外 資的作爲帶來負面影響。其次,鼓勵外資政策通常標誌著國家對跨國 企業之較爲可信的承諾,以維繫和平的環境。由此,採行鼓勵外資政 策的國家較少會主動開啓軍事衝突。本研究透過1970年至2001年期 間的統計資料,分析鼓勵外資政策與國家開啓衝突間的關聯。研究結 果顯示,鼓勵外資的總體政策與國家發動衝突有統計顯著性的負面相 關。換言之,提倡外資政策具有減少國家主動開啓軍事衝突的促和效 果,亦可知鼓勵外資政策隱含國家具有較低衝突意願的傾向。

英文摘要

Are states with pro-FDI policies less conflict-prone? This paper examines plausible linkages between a state’s FDI promotion policy and its desire to initiate conflicts. By focusing on the willingness of the state, I argue that pro-FDI policy may reveal the state’s propensity to preserve peace for two reasons. First, pro-FDI policy is incompatible with conflict initiation since the negative effects of the latter offset the state’s efforts to increase FDI inflow by the former. Second, pro-FDI policy tends to be credible when it explicitly addresses the state’s commitments to multinationals. Hence, states undertaking pro-FDI policies are less likely to initiate conflict in general. By employing various pro-FDI policy indicators, I test the FDI-conflict initiation relationship at the monadic level from 1970 to 2001. Statistical results show that while macro-pro-FDI policies are negatively associated with conflict initiation, treaty-pro-FDI policies do not have the same effect. At both theoretical and empirical levels, this study advances the understanding of the FDI-conflict relationship by demonstrating the possible pacifying effects that pro-FDI policy might have on conflict initiation, and reveals that states with pro-FDI policy tend to be less conflict-prone.
